Google bigquery Google Bigquery表装饰器

Google bigquery Google Bigquery表装饰器,google-bigquery,Google Bigquery,我需要添加装饰,将代表从6天前到现在 我该怎么做 假设从现在算起,日期为604800000毫秒,绝对值为1427061600000毫秒 @-604800000 @1427061600000 @现在单位为毫-1427061600000 @1427061600000-现在单位为毫秒 使用相对时间和绝对时间有区别吗 谢谢我想你所需要的就是阅读 基本上,您可以选择@time,这是自大纪元以来的时间(您的@1427061600000)。您还可以将其表示为负数,系统将其解释为NOW-time(您的@-6

我需要添加装饰,将代表从6天前到现在

我该怎么做

假设从现在算起,日期为604800000毫秒,绝对值为1427061600000毫秒

  • @-604800000
  • @1427061600000
  • @现在单位为毫-1427061600000
  • @1427061600000-现在单位为毫秒
使用相对时间和绝对时间有区别吗


谢谢

我想你所需要的就是阅读

基本上,您可以选择
@time
,这是自大纪元以来的时间(您的
@1427061600000
)。您还可以将其表示为负数,系统将其解释为
NOW-time
(您的
@-604800000
)。这两种方法都有效,但它们不会产生你想要的结果。它将返回6天前的表快照,而不是返回在该时间范围内添加的所有内容

尽管您可以使用该快照,消除该快照与当前表之间的所有重复项,然后将这些结果作为您在6天内添加的结果,但您最好使用以下方法:


直接使用时间范围,用第三行和第四行覆盖。我不知道顺序是否有区别,但我一直使用
@time1-time2
time1我想你所需要的就是阅读

基本上,您可以选择
@time
,这是自大纪元以来的时间(您的
@1427061600000
)。您还可以将其表示为负数,系统将其解释为
NOW-time
(您的
@-604800000
)。这两种方法都有效,但它们不会产生你想要的结果。它将返回6天前的表快照,而不是返回在该时间范围内添加的所有内容

尽管您可以使用该快照,消除该快照与当前表之间的所有重复项,然后将这些结果作为您在6天内添加的结果,但您最好使用以下方法:

直接使用时间范围,用第三行和第四行覆盖。我不知道顺序是否有区别,但我总是将
@time1-time2
time1一起使用
将为您提供过去6天(或过去144小时)的数据

将为您提供过去6天(或过去144小时)的数据

@-518400000--1